Holds Over

A term describing a tenant who remains in possession of leased property after the expiration of the lease term without the landlord's consent.

Tenancy for Years

A leasehold interest in property for a fixed period that is greater than one year.

Month-to-Month Tenancy

A type of rental agreement that does not have a set end date but continues on a monthly basis until either party decides to terminate it.

Tenancy at Will

A rental agreement allowing a tenant to occupy property for an indefinite period, terminable by either landlord or tenant at any time.
